diff options
author | Kazunori Kajihiro <kazunori.kajihiro@gmail.com> | 2017-10-13 11:55:36 +0900 |
---|---|---|
committer | Kazunori Kajihiro <kazunori.kajihiro@gmail.com> | 2017-10-13 11:55:36 +0900 |
commit | 34d7b05d277e96d31cab40f7818dcc2e8b107a30 (patch) | |
tree | 29ac68c63b8ce5eb068a9699e4892edaa03e25ca /activejob/test/jobs | |
parent | 4a13c1e1d2496657f35a7a35092d1b403fe03526 (diff) | |
download | rails-34d7b05d277e96d31cab40f7818dcc2e8b107a30.tar.gz rails-34d7b05d277e96d31cab40f7818dcc2e8b107a30.tar.bz2 rails-34d7b05d277e96d31cab40f7818dcc2e8b107a30.zip |
Test exception message to ensure an exception instance is yielded
Diffstat (limited to 'activejob/test/jobs')
-rw-r--r-- | activejob/test/jobs/retry_job.rb |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/activejob/test/jobs/retry_job.rb b/activejob/test/jobs/retry_job.rb index a12d09779b..9aa99d9a21 100644 --- a/activejob/test/jobs/retry_job.rb +++ b/activejob/test/jobs/retry_job.rb @@ -17,7 +17,7 @@ class RetryJob < ActiveJob::Base retry_on ShortWaitTenAttemptsError, wait: 1.second, attempts: 10 retry_on ExponentialWaitTenAttemptsError, wait: :exponentially_longer, attempts: 10 retry_on CustomWaitTenAttemptsError, wait: ->(executions) { executions * 2 }, attempts: 10 - retry_on(CustomCatchError) { |job, exception| JobBuffer.add("Dealt with a job that failed to retry in a custom way after #{job.arguments.second} attempts") } + retry_on(CustomCatchError) { |job, exception| JobBuffer.add("Dealt with a job that failed to retry in a custom way after #{job.arguments.second} attempts. Message: #{exception.message}") } discard_on DiscardableError def perform(raising, attempts) |